The setting was fantastic with all the cliffs in clear view. In December the cabin was chilly but heated up quickly with the heaters. We loved the wood stove which made for cozy evenings. The kitchen was very well equipped. The books on the corner table were wonderful to learn about the area. Even though it was cold out, the south facing patio was warm in the afternoon and provided a perfect spot to sit with a hot beverage after hiking. We hiked the south fork Cave Creek trail and were amazed at the variety of plants, trees and desert flora along the way. Incomparable beauty! We also hiked trails at the end of the road past the research station and were delighted to find two waterfalls.

From Tucson, take I-10 east for 139 miles to Road Forks, NM. Turn right (south) on US 80 and drive 28 miles to Portal Road. Turn right (west) and drive 7 miles to the town of Portal. Turn left on Forest Road 42 into Cave Creek Canyon; the signed gate to the Portal CCC House is approximately 0.9 miles on the right.

Policies & Rules
General
- Pets are NOT permitted inside or outside the cabin. Unfortunately, due to a history of pet owners inadequately cleaning up after their pets, pets are no longer allowed. Forest Service staff have limited time to complete weekly cabin cleaning. Cleaning service is not cost effective due to the rural location of the cabins. Eliminating the need to vacuum pet hair, neutralize odors, and pick up poop frees up staff time to cleaning cabin amenities and address repair needs.
- Access to the cabin is via a driveway on the east side of the facility, accessible by passenger car. The house key is located in a lock box on the front door nearest to the parking area. The combination for the lock box is provided once a reservation is made.
- A cabin manual is located inside the cabin to answer specific questions during your stay as well as provide you with information on recreation opportunities in the area.
- Cleaning service is NOT provided. Before leaving, renters are expected to clean the cabin; this includes washing dishes, sweeping floors, wiping down countertops, cleaning the bathroom & shower, and removing ALL trash.
- Guests MUST provide some of their own supplies including: food, sleeping bags, linens, pillows, towels, dish soap, matches, a first aid kit, toilet paper and garbage bags.
- Please do NOT flush anything but toilet paper to prevent clogs or damage to the septic system.
- Keep the building and grounds clean to deter squirrel, rodents, bears, and other wildlife from the area.
- Cell phone coverage is usually available in the area, but may be unreliable in the cabin.
- The house is located in a desert environment; please be aware that scorpions, snakes, and other insects may be present at any time.
- Off-Highway vehicles are only allowed on designated roads and trails.
- The cabin is a no-smoking facility.
- Access is subject to weather conditions.
- This cabin does not honor Golden Age Discounts.
